How do I stop downloading phone applications on a new device:
The major app platforms all have automatic app updates, and the default setting for this is ‘on’. You can stop automatic downloading or turn off all updates.
- First Open Google Play store.
- Tap your Gmail Logo from the top-right corner.
- Tap on settings.
- Tap General.
- Now tap on auto-update apps.
- To prevent automatic app updates or downloading, select Don’t auto-update app.
- Tap Done.

If your app still hasn’t stopped downloading, it may be from your phone’s App Store. Companies like Samsung, Redmi, Vivo, etc. give us our own app store along with the phone.
This can be stopped if the app is being downloaded from your Galaxy App Store, Mi GetApp Store, or V-AppStore.
Here’s How to stop downloading phone applications from your phone app store (V-AppStore).
- First, open your phone app store (Galaxy store, Mi Getapp store, or V-AppStore).
- Tap on the download arrow.
- Then tap on the Downloading app.
- Now you will see the delete icon and tap on it.
